upng's Introduction

uPNG -- derived from LodePNG version 20100808

==========================================

This project is fork by there

MODIFY

  • 1 add a way to ouput data, so you can decode image data into preallocated buffers.

TEST

  • If you need to deocde a png image and store the raw data into a preallocated buffer, you need use upng_decode_to_buffer() fun. Like that upng_decode_to_buffer(upng, (unsigned char *)decoder_buffer, sizeof(decoder_buffer));.

  • The size of preallocated buffer is must have a minimum size of that png file size plus width*height*3.
